In BFLS’s 2004 ranking, the top 100 distributors had total sales of $2.78 billion. However, 2005 saw a significant drop to $2.34 billion, largely a result of the skewed data. The dip was short-lived and this year, the top 100 distributors boasted sales of $2.91 billion, an enormous 24.4 percent increase over last year.
